在线看毛片网站电影-亚洲国产欧美日韩精品一区二区三区,国产欧美乱夫不卡无乱码,国产精品欧美久久久天天影视,精品一区二区三区视频在线观看,亚洲国产精品人成乱码天天看,日韩久久久一区,91精品国产91免费

<menu id="6qfwx"><li id="6qfwx"></li></menu>
    1. <menu id="6qfwx"><dl id="6qfwx"></dl></menu>

      <label id="6qfwx"><ol id="6qfwx"></ol></label><menu id="6qfwx"></menu><object id="6qfwx"><strike id="6qfwx"><noscript id="6qfwx"></noscript></strike></object>
        1. <center id="6qfwx"><dl id="6qfwx"></dl></center>

            新聞中心

            EEPW首頁 > 嵌入式系統(tǒng) > 設計應用 > 基于CANopen總線與PLC的液壓試驗平臺控制系統(tǒng)設計

            基于CANopen總線與PLC的液壓試驗平臺控制系統(tǒng)設計

            作者: 時間:2016-12-20 來源:網(wǎng)絡 收藏

            1 引言

            147裝置為某空中收放式受油裝置,需要沒計多個專用液壓試驗臺對該產(chǎn)品的一些性能(如:收放性能、密封性能、強度性能等)進行檢測并驗證。本文所涉及的液壓試驗平臺控制系統(tǒng)即針對該147裝置的液壓試驗平臺所設計。

            該項目需要進行的試驗內(nèi)容較多且耗時,各個試驗平臺分布于廠房的不同位置,且試驗臺工作環(huán)境比較惡劣(如高低溫試驗時工作環(huán)境溫度高溫85攝氏度,低溫40攝氏度)。各個試驗平臺與上位機之間基于CANopen總線通訊,其中上位機作為CANopen通訊主站。各個試驗臺現(xiàn)場采用德國倍福(BECKHOFF)的BX5100系列PLC,該PLC具有CANopen總線接口,實現(xiàn)與上位機的cANopen通訊,并且作為CANopen總線網(wǎng)絡的從站。

            BX5100型PLC能夠根據(jù)實際需要選用用戶所需的各個規(guī)格的數(shù)字量輸入模塊、數(shù)字量輸出模塊、模擬量輸入模塊、模擬量輸出模塊,以及其他一些復雜模塊如脈沖輸出模塊等(主要用于控制步進電機),能非常靈活的滿足實際工程中的各種需求。并且該PLC配備支持MODBUS RTU通訊協(xié)議的串口,只要應用一個PLC通訊庫文件就能非常方便的與威倫通(Wdn訪ew)MT6070iH型人機界面(HMI)通訊,可方便操作人員在試驗臺現(xiàn)場對液壓平臺進行操作,無需通過遠端的上位機,提供了另一種操作選擇。

            2 CANopen總線簡介

            CAN是Controller Area Network的縮寫,是德國BOSCH公司為現(xiàn)代汽車應用領先推出的一種多主機局部網(wǎng),由于其高性能、高可靠性、實時性等優(yōu)點現(xiàn)已廣泛應用于工業(yè)自動化、多種控制設備、交通工具、醫(yī)療儀器以及建筑、環(huán)境控制等眾多部門。

            CANopen是在CAN的基礎上發(fā)展起來的,它基于CAN的數(shù)據(jù)鏈路層和物理層,對應用層做出了相應的規(guī)定,成為歐洲嵌入式網(wǎng)絡的主要標準協(xié)議(EN50325-4)。

            一個CANopcn設備模型如圖1所,分成二個部分:通訊接口、對象詞典、應用程序。

            (1)通訊接口提供在總線土發(fā)送和接收通訊對象的服務。

            (2)對象詞典是CANopen協(xié)議中最重要的概念,它描述了所有的數(shù)據(jù)類型、通訊對象以及設備指定的對象,是連接應用和通訊之間的媒介。通過訪問對象詞典可以得知各節(jié)點的狀態(tài)、確定網(wǎng)絡的通訊,摸式、選抒相應的網(wǎng)絡管理,與輸入輸出端口相接、存儲具體應用中的輸入輸出數(shù)據(jù)。

            (3)應用程序提供了內(nèi)部控制功能,也提洪了與硬件連接的接口。

            點擊放大圖片

            圖1 CANopen設備模型

            過積數(shù)據(jù)對象即PDO(Provess bata Object)主要用來傳輸實時數(shù)據(jù),例如電機速度、位置、I/O值等。實時數(shù)據(jù)以8個字節(jié)封裝成個PDO,PD0按照用途分為兩種:

            (1)TxPDOs用于實時數(shù)據(jù)的發(fā)送

            (2)RxPDOs用于實時數(shù)據(jù)的接收

            3 試驗平臺控制系統(tǒng)硬件實現(xiàn)

            本項目控制系統(tǒng)中各個試驗平臺與上位機之間采用基于CANopen總線通訊??刂葡到y(tǒng)拓撲結(jié)構(gòu)見圖2:

            點擊放大圖片

            圖2 控制系統(tǒng)拓撲結(jié)構(gòu)

            其中上位機通過倍福FC5101型CANopen卡接入CANopen總線網(wǎng)絡,并作為CANOpen通訊主站(Master)。


            上一頁 1 2 下一頁

            評論


            技術專區(qū)

            關閉